Default When to replace your bow string?

I'm just curious. When should you replace the bow string on your bow? Every year? Every other? Every three years? Just wondering how often people do this.

It does depend a lot on how much the bow is shot and how much abrasion the strings are subjected to. I would never leave a set on any longer than 2 years and I'd change them sooner if the Bow got a lot of use.
